lau-ecom-design-system
v1.0.30
Published
- Name: Design System LAUREATE E-COMMERCE - Package name: lau-ecom-design-system
Readme
Design System LAUREATE E-COMMERCE
- Name: Design System LAUREATE E-COMMERCE
- Package name: lau-ecom-design-system
Development
# Instalar dependencias
yarn install
# Levantar storybook
yarn storybook
# Publicar una nueva versión de la liberería
npm run build or yarn build
npm pack
npm publishQuick Setup
- Agrege la dependencia
lau-ecom-design-systema su proyecto
#Usando Yarn
yarn add lau-ecom-design-system- Para un proyecto de Nuxt, agregue el siguiente archivo plugins/lau-ecom-design-system.js y edite nuxt.config.ts con lo siguiente:
//plugins/lau-ecom-design-system.js
import { defineNuxtPlugin } from "#app";
import designsystem from "lau-ecom-design-system/dist/lau-ecom-design-system.ssr";
import "lau-ecom-design-system/dist/style.css";
import "lau-ecom-design-system/dist/lau-ecom-design-system.esm.css";
export default defineNuxtPlugin((nuxtApp) => {
// Doing something with nuxtApp
nuxtApp.vueApp.use(designsystem);
});//nuxt.config.ts
// https://nuxt.com/docs/api/configuration/nuxt-config
export default defineNuxtConfig({
devtools: { enabled: false },
plugins: ["~/plugins/lau-ecom-design-system.js"],
});- Para un proyecto de Vue, edite el archivo main.ts con lo siguiente:
//main.ts
import designsystem from "lau-ecom-design-system/dist/lau-ecom-design-system.esm";
import "lau-ecom-design-system/dist/style.css";
import "lau-ecom-design-system/dist/lau-ecom-design-system.esm.css";
app.use(designsystem);